The XTT Cell Viability Kit detects formazan dye produced from XTT conversion by mitochondrial enzymes in cells. Because these mitochondrial enzymes are inactivated shortly after cell death, the orange colored formazan dye only appears in viable cells. This XTT Cell Viability Kit is expected to work in most cells lines. Variable with cell type and incubation time employed in the assay, 0.2-2x104 cells/well should be sufficient for most experiments. For the best result, a cell number titration (as shown in Figure 1) is recommended.
The Resazurin Cell Viability Kit detects resorufin produced from resazurin conversion by metabolic enzymes in live cells. This kit is expected to work in most cell lines. For most experiments, 0.02-2x105 cells/well should be sufficient, but this can vary depending on the cell type and incubation time. For best results, a cell number titration and incubation time course (as shown in Figure 1) is recommended. Note: Microbial contaminants will reduce resazurin to resorufin, yielding false positive results. Autofluorescent compounds may interfere with this assay.
